Quote from: Testset on January 12, 2014, 01:32:18 PM
Emrakul is a creature like any other, so "sac a creature" applies to him. If an effect require you to sacrifice, bounce, buff, or damage anything, you must do so until either the criteria was met, or no legal options remain.

It's the same reason why a {Simic Growth Chamber} must bounce itself if its controller had other lands on the battlefield when playing it and a {Fiend Hunter} must exile one of its controller's creatures if their opponent had none under their control when he enters the battlefield. Not fun, but must be done.


{fiend hunter} states the player MAY exile a creature. It's not a requirement to exile one of your own creatures when playing fiend hunter and the opponent doesn't have any creatures.
